The Phillie Phanatic paid a special visit to Mary Roberts Elementary School on April 16. Students in the first-grade class of teacher Bridget Potts participated in Phanatic About Reading, a free program that encourages students from pre-K through eighth grade to read or be read to for a minimum of 15 minutes a day to improve their literacy skills. The students consistently met or passed their goals.
